Matias Vecino has been named UEFA Europa League Player of the Week after his two goals and an assist in Lazio’s 4-2 win over Feyenoord.

The 31-year-old Uruguay international dominated the match at the Stadio Olimpico last night.

He found the net twice and set up the opener for Luis Alberto, in a game that Lazio were leading 4-0.

Felipe Anderson completed the rout on a pass from Ciro Immobile.

Vecino’s performance earned him the title of UEFA Europa League Player of the Week.
